Anyone who knows Hawaii knows the greeting is a Shaka, means everything's okay or everything's good. Only used in Hawaii that I know of.
You fold the middle 3 fingers back and extent the thump and pinky and rock the hand back and forth.
If someone recognizes you across a room or parking lot, rather than wave, they will do the Shaka and when they leave, instead of waving goodbye - they tuck middle fingers, extend the pinky and thumb and wobble the hand back and forth.
